121 businesses start up every day
The Trade Register recorded 30,622 new businesses in 2010, meaning an average of 121 businesses were set up each working day. 2010 saw the registration of 15,866 private traders and 12,389 limited liability companies. The number of new businesses grew by 3 per cent from 2009.
At the end of the year, there were 530,000 businesses and housing companies in the Trade Register. The limited liability company is still the most popular type of business listed, but most of the new businesses are private traders.

Information about new businesses
You can look at the new registrations on the Trade Register’s electronic information service on published entries. For example, you can search for business details listed on the register on a certain day – past or present – by entering the date and selecting “establishment” as the type of registration. The search will return a list with these headings: Business ID, company name, type of registration, record number and registration date. Clicking on the date takes you to the relevant details, which include the company’s basic details, and information about the publication.
More detailed information about all businesses in the Trade Register is available from the Virre Information Service, from which you can purchase an electronic Trade Register extract for a given business, and, through company search, you can browse both current details and history for information such as a limited liability company’s previous Boards of Directors.
